Looking Back

10 YEARS AGO
Brittany Attaway is named Newcomer of the Year in District 15AAA volleyball. Samantha Brummell made the first team and Tequila Jennings and Dominique White earned spots on the second team.
A 12-year-old child escaped injury after being struck by a vehicle in front of the Rock Gym.
Wanda Mitchell receives a 100 percent attendance pin from the Pittsburg Lions Club.
20 YEARS AGO
Mr. and Mrs. Robert Loughery win first place in the holiday lighting contest. Second place goes to Mr. and Mrs. Kenneth Davis, and Mr. and Mrs. Oscar Edwards take third.
A rabid skunk is found in the county.
Joe Mata, Toby Montgomery and Gabe Wamble make District 14AAA All-District team.
30 YEARS AGO
Thoroughbred horses being trained at Sunbelt Stables on Farm-to-Market Road 556.
All-District football selections include head coach Ronnie Menn as coach of the year and Mark Cooper as the most valuable player on offense. Other Pirates making the first team were Greg Cook, Brad Sewell, Chris McPeak, Keith Sewell, Reggie Wright, Matt Emery and Bobby Henry.
Pittsburg Fire Department hosts a training and testing project in conjunction with the fire training section of the Texas Forest Service.
